两块晶体衍射增强成像方法研究

Study on the methods for diffraction-enhanced imaging with two crystals

  • 在北京同步辐射装置4W1A光束线形貌学实验站用两块晶体开展了衍射增强成像方法的实验和理论研究.研究了晶体热膨胀对两块晶体衍射增强成像的影响,分析的结论表明,晶体转轴垂直于同步辐射偏振面能基本避免晶体热膨胀的影响,获得较好的成像质量.实验结果证实了分析的正确性.

     

    Diffraction_enhanced imaging by using two crystals has been recently developed i n x_ray topogrphy station in Beijing Synchrotron Radiation Facility. In this art icle the analysis for the influence of the thermal expansion of the first crysta l on the diffraction enhanced imaging is presented. The conclusion is that the i nfluence of the thermal expansion of the first crystal can be avoided and much b etter images can be obtained when the axes of crystals are placed vertically to the polarization plane of the synchrotron radiation. The experimental results co nfirmed this analysis.
